Well following in my heroes footsteps
(Blackmore, Malmsteen) New record , new singer of course. I
wanted this disc to be a bit more retro, more of a Deep Purple/Rainbow type of thing and little less on the speed metal side.
And with Brian Troch's raspy bluesier voice and the obvious
Rainbow/Purple plagiarisms in The Devil's Playground, All Things
Must End , Take Your Life and Change I think managed just that.
And as I go back and listen to some of the tracks years later
, some the riffs and nice melodies really hold up over time.
I remember many of the longer solos are all totally improvised
(You Turn My World Around, All Things Must End, Hell and Back)
and it's always great to capture some very inspired playing
onto tape. Plus you can't beat that two Strat metal messiah
cover shot on the Japanese edition of the CD. Leviathan is considering
re-releasing both this and Light In The Sky as a double pack
sometime this year so perhaps they'll resurface.
